The cheapest way to get from Soho to Redbridge is to bus which costs £13 - £17 and takes 3h 44m.
The fastest way to get from Soho to Redbridge is to drive which takes 1h 33m and costs £19 - £29.
No, there is no direct bus from Soho to Redbridge. However, there are services departing from Regent Street / St James's and arriving at Redbridge Roundabout via Heathrow Terminal 5 and Central Station.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 3h 44m.
The distance between Soho and Redbridge is 83 miles. The road distance is 79 miles.
The best way to get from Soho to Redbridge without a car is to train which takes 1h 59m and costs £19 - £70.
It takes approximately 1h 59m to get from Soho to Redbridge, including transfers.
Soho to Redbridge bus services, operated by Metroline Travel, depart from Regent Street / St James's station.
The best way to get from Soho to Redbridge is to train which takes 1h 59m and costs £19 - £70. Alternatively, you can bus, which costs £13 - £17 and takes 3h 44m.
Soho to Redbridge bus services, operated by Metroline Travel, arrive at Heathrow Terminal 5 station.
Yes, the driving distance between Soho to Redbridge is 79 miles. It takes approximately 1h 33m to drive from Soho to Redbridge.

South Western Railway operates a train from London Waterloo to Southampton Central hourly. Tickets cost £15–65 and the journey takes 1h 13m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Regent Street / St James's to Redbridge Roundabout via Heathrow Terminal 5, Southampton Central Station, and Central Station in around 3h 44m.
